Kinds Of Bamboo Flooring


There are three standard alternatives: strand-woven, vertical, and also straight. Home owners can pick which sort of bamboo flooring to get based upon their qualities. The purchaser's intended visual impacts the chosen Bamboo flooring kind.

Solid - Upright Bamboo Flooring


Slim strips of dry bamboo timber glued up and down and pushed utilizing high warmth and also stress produce this sort of bamboo flooring.
The thinnest side of the bamboo planks will certainly be in an upright form. After that, a company bonding, pressing, as well as lamination will adhere to. As a result of their technique of joining, the bamboo strips include a slim grain pattern.
The good thing concerning this type of bamboo flooring is that it is extremely cost effective and long lasting. Likewise, it offers a classy and stylish floor surface. It is not widely offered.

Solid - Straight Bamboo Flooring


You will certainly observe that this type is practically the like upright bamboo flooring. It has a small variation. Straight bamboo is one of the most popular types of bamboo flooring.
It is made by drying out significant strips of bamboo, cutting these larger pieces into thinner strips, and after that gluing them to develop slabs. The boards will certainly after that be subject to pressure as well as warmth to guarantee they are well attached.
Natural bamboo has a lighter shade. While carbonized bamboo will be less tough than normal bamboo, if you require a darker color, it may do you excellent.

Strand Woven Bamboo Flooring


Shredding the bamboo to extract the fibers is one of the a lot more enticing steps in generating strand-woven bamboo floorings.
The bamboo fiber is frequently combined with an adhesive after it's made to a pulp. The material is after that weaved as well as compressed under wonderful warmth, as the name suggests.
After making horizontal and also upright bamboo, the strips offer to create hair woven bamboo. The eco-conscious purchaser might discover this function appealing. The factor is that it guarantees that the entire bamboo stalk generates really little waste.

Engineered Bamboo Flooring


Both solid as well as engineered bamboo flooring choices are available. Once the bamboo timber fits, it isn't very easy to distinguish between them.
Their distinctions are due to their making. Crafted bamboo wood has a slim plywood backing.
Yet, whether engineered or strong, bamboo flooring is durable, durable, and also eye-catching.
Engineered bamboo flooring makes use of the floating timber flooring over a slim foam base. They might also be in the kind of broad slabs. As an example, they are readily available in widths approximately 19 centimeters.

Bamboo Kitchen Floor Tips


Bamboo is a beautiful choice for flooring that also has sustainable, eco-friendly properties. Whether it’s your main living space or other areas of your home, bamboo flooring is an excellent way to give a room an upgrade. Since it has many excellent properties, it’s easy to see why so many homeowners are choosing a bamboo kitchen floor. If you currently have a bamboo kitchen floor or you’re considering getting it, read on for some helpful tips and information to help you get started on your quest.


Bamboo flooring comes in various formats including solid, engineered, and strand woven. Since this natural material is extremely hardy, it makes a perfect choice for kitchens. Even with fluctuations in temperature, moisture levels, and humidity, bamboo can withstand these changes without any damage. Kitchens are especially vulnerable to moisture due to things like spills, humidity from cooking, and potential plumbing leaks. Unlike some other forms of flooring, bamboo won’t warp or buckle if you clean up spills quickly. If you want something extremely durable for your cooking space, consider engineered bamboo flooring. This material has a waterproof layer on the bottom of the planks to protect your subfloor.


How Susceptible is Bamboo to Water?


Any type of flooring can undergo damage if it’s exposed to water, particularly if the water sits on the surface for a long period of time. However, bamboo is much more durable and able to handle water than hardwood floors, which tend to absorb moisture and expand. In general, a bamboo kitchen floor can resist water for about 30 hours. As long as you address and clean up the spill within this timeframe, your floors should be unaffected. Some bamboo flooring styles are more resilient than others.



Do your research and learn more about each type and manufacturer so you know which bamboo will suit your needs best. Strand woven bamboo has approximately 20 hours of water protection. Never allow moisture to sit on top of your bamboo floors, and they should last for many years.


Is Bamboo Difficult to Clean?


The kitchen is without a doubt one of the messiest places in your home. From spilled food and water to lots of foot traffic, you want to make sure that your bamboo kitchen floor is easy to keep clean. To remove crumbs and dirt, use a vacuum cleaner without a beater bar, as this could scratch the floors. A broom and dustpan make cleaning up small debris a cinch without worrying about causing any damage. For deep cleaning, use a mop with a soft microfiber head.



Make sure any commercial cleaning products you use on your bamboo kitchen floor are pH neutral. This will preserve your floor finish, as anything that’s too acidic can eat away the surface and create unsightly spots. Always read the ingredients and directions on any floor cleaning products before you buy them or use them on your bamboo. For quick spot cleaning, a simple spritz of water and a paper towel or soft cloth should suffice.


Decide on a Style of Bamboo


Bamboo flooring is available in three basic styles: solid, engineered, and strand woven. Each one has its own unique properties, price points, and advantages. It’s important to understand the differences between these bamboo styles before you make a decision. Once you know more about them, it’s much easier to determine which one will work best for your budget, your home, and your lifestyle. Let’s take a closer look at these bamboo floor styles:



Solid



This type of bamboo has the most natural look of all the different styles. Solid bamboo is more labor-intensive when it comes to installation, but it also has a beautiful aesthetic. The material can be sanded down and refinished if you want to give it a new look or remove stubborn dents or stains. Since this material is glued or nailed to the subfloor, you should be especially vigilant about cleaning up spills to avoid any issues due to moisture exposure.



Engineered



When it comes to affordability, engineered bamboo flooring is an excellent choice. This material is manufactured by applying a very thin later of natural bamboo over an engineered backing material. The result is a bamboo look without the high price tag, and it performs well in kitchen areas. Engineered bamboo is very moisture resistant, however, it cannot be sanded or re-stained. With proper care, engineered bamboo should last for many years.



Strand Woven



This flooring is made from weaving bamboo fibers together at a 90-degree angle. The result is a flooring material that has exceptional strength and durability. Similar to solid bamboo flooring, strand woven styles can be sanded and refinished if you desire. Since it’s a highly durable option, it’s perfect for busy kitchens and busy households. This bamboo is twice as strong as oak and is also the most environmentally friendly of all three styles.
